The Not So Secret Life of a Plumber and his Apprentice
We wanted to introduce you to Glen Douglass, one of our apprentices, and Andrew Shelton, his boss. They are both part of the MEGT Group Training Program.
Glen left high school and did a pre-apprenticeship in plumbing, which was a 3 month course at trade school. After finishing this course he had skills that enabled him to look for a job as an apprentice. He is now in his second year.
Andrew Shelton employs four plumbing apprentices who have been through MEGT, including Glen. He highly recommends the program. He’s saved hours of bookwork and administration costs because MEGT organises all the annual leave, sick leave, superannuation etc… for his employees.
The program includes a secure mentoring system for apprentices. This guidance ensures that apprentices always have a support network through their training. For example, if there are unsafe or unsatisfactory work practices on a site they can report to their expert field officer.
